Job Brief
The Production Control Coordinator is responsible for coordinating and expediting the flow of work and materials within various departments, ensuring adherence to production schedules. This role requires a detail-oriented professional with a strong background in production management, inventory control, and process optimization. Key skills include effective communication, problem-solving, and proficiency in production planning software.
Responsibilities
- Coordinate the flow of work and materials according to production schedules to meet operational targets.
- Review and distribute production, work, and shipment schedules to relevant departments.
- Confer with department supervisors to monitor progress, address production issues, and determine completion dates.
- Compile and analyze reports on work progress, inventory levels, production costs, and problem resolution.
- Implement process improvements to enhance production efficiency and quality.
- Assist in inventory management and ensure optimal stock levels are maintained.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ment on production goals and timelines.
- Maintain accurate records of production activities and prepare necessary documentation for audits.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, or a related field.
- Proven experience in production control, manufacturing, or logistics coordination.
- Strong understanding of production planning processes and inventory management systems.
- Proficiency in scheduling and production planning software (e.g., ERP systems).
- Excellent analytical, organizational, and multitasking skills.
- Effective communication skills, both written and verbal, for collaboration with teams.
- Ability to troubleshoot production issues and implement effective solutions.
- Knowledge of Lean Manufacturing principles is a plus.
